Earlier this week we really enjoyed playing at the Brighton Pavilions in their beautiful music room. The music room is part of the Royal Pavilion built as a sea side retreat for the Prince Regent in the 19th Century. The famous blind harpist John Parry used to play here and apparently his harp was on show for a number of years before being moved back to London. The room is incredibly ornate with wonderful oriental wall carvings and vibrant carpets and walls. Our four harps looked amazing amidst the sumptious decor and it was really inspiring to be performing in such surroundings.
